Configuring a terminal and SDI ports
Procedure 65

Connecting SDI ports on the Media Gateways

1
Connect the NTBK48 3-port SDI cable to the 9-pin SDI port (RS-232) at
the rear of the Media Gateways (see Figure 122).

2
Connect the system terminal to the cable marked "port 0" on the NTBK48
3-port cable. You require a Modem Eliminator adapter to connect the
system to a TTY terminal. This adapter is included in the CS 1000E and
the Media Gateway cable kits.
3
If the system is accessed remotely, connect the system modem to the
cable marked "port 1" on the NTBK48 cable.
4
When instructed, connect the modem to an outside line.
5
When instructed, test the modem for correct operation when the system
is operating.
Note: You can use the remaining ports for other equipment, such as
CDR devices or TTYs.
